About Antitrust Litigation Law in Manosque, France

Antitrust litigation in Manosque, France, refers to legal actions designed to address and resolve disputes regarding anti-competitive behavior among businesses. These disputes usually arise when companies engage in activities that restrict competition, such as price fixing, market sharing, bid rigging, or abuse of dominance. The goal of antitrust law is to promote healthy market competition for the benefit of consumers and the economy. While France has national laws governing antitrust matters, such as the French Commercial Code and European Union regulations, these laws are enforced locally in places like Manosque by specialized courts and authorities.

Local Laws Overview

Antitrust litigation in Manosque is primarily governed by national French law, particularly Book IV of the French Commercial Code, and is influenced by relevant European Union competition law. The French Competition Authority oversees antitrust matters, which include prohibiting cartels, abuse of dominant positions, and enforcing merger controls. Legal proceedings related to antitrust issues can be initiated before civil or commercial courts in Manosque and may involve complex legal and economic analyses. Penalties for violating antitrust laws can include substantial fines, remedies to restore competition, or even criminal sanctions in severe cases. Local businesses should be aware that even unintentional breaches can lead to serious legal consequences.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is considered anti-competitive behavior under French antitrust law?

Anti-competitive behavior includes activities such as price fixing, market sharing, collusive bidding, and abusing a dominant market position to hinder competitors.

Who can initiate an antitrust lawsuit in Manosque?

Both companies and individuals who have suffered harm due to anti-competitive practices may initiate legal action. Additionally, the Competition Authority or public prosecutors can bring cases.

What sanctions can be imposed for violating antitrust laws?

Sanctions can include administrative fines, compensation for damages, or in some cases, criminal penalties for responsible individuals.

Are small businesses affected by antitrust laws?

Yes, all businesses regardless of size must comply with antitrust rules. However, the impact may differ depending on the business’s market influence.

How are antitrust laws enforced in Manosque?

Enforcement is carried out by the French Competition Authority, with local courts handling related litigation and enforcement actions in the Manosque area.

Can I defend against an antitrust investigation?

Yes, you have the right to legal representation, defense, and to present evidence during investigations and hearings.

What should I do if I am accused of anti-competitive behavior?

Seek immediate legal advice from a qualified antitrust lawyer familiar with both national and local proceedings.

What is the statute of limitations for antitrust claims in France?

Generally, the statute of limitations is five years from when the violation became known to the harmed party.

Is mediation available in antitrust disputes?

Yes, in some cases parties can use mediation or settlement to resolve disputes before or during litigation.

Can foreign companies be subject to antitrust litigation in Manosque?

Yes, if their activities affect the French market, foreign companies can be investigated and prosecuted under French antitrust law.
